Genmai is usually the phrase for “brown rice” in Japanese, but many of the roasted rice is in fact manufactured with white rice. Because each the roasted rice of genmaicha and brown rice use exactly the same word, it’s a little perplexing.

The proportions of this blended tea, tend to be half rice and 50 % tea. Also, genmaicha has generally been deemed an easy every single day tea, for that reason decrease grade tea is usually utilized.

Genmaicha is usually a combination of tea with roasted rice. Usually, Japanese teas used to be pure only, thus this previously makes it very an exception. How did this take place? There are numerous theories and histories regarding the origins of this tea. To generally be straightforward, it is sort of difficult to understand which just one is the true a single. Some legends say that a servant dropped – possibly accidentally or on purpose – some grains of rice into the tea cup of his samurai master.
